      The home - team, George Cross, is currently in the middle of the league standings. In 18 rounds, they've achieved 6 wins, 7 draws, and 5 losses. Their performance in both attack and defense lacks balance. They've scored 24 goals and conceded 25, showing obvious flaws in their defense. In the last five games, they've conceded more than two goals per game on average. Their home - field strength is weak. In the last six home games, they've only had 1 win, 2 draws, and 3 losses. Their goal - scoring efficiency at home is low. In the recent ten games, they've had 4 wins, 2 draws, and 4 losses, with an inconsistent form as wins and losses alternate. Their midfield struggles to continuously contain high - intensity attacks. On the other hand, the away - team, Oakleigh Cannons, sits firmly at the top of the league.
